    The Crucial Role of Oracles in Blockchain

    Oracles serve as a critical component of blockchain infrastructure, facilitating secure communication between external real-world data and on-chain environments. This role is especially pivotal in decentralized finance (DeFi) and Web3 applications, where reliable data is essential for the execution of smart contracts.

    UMA’s Optimistic Oracle Design

    UMA’s Oracle distinguishes itself through its optimistic design, employing a “true unless disputed” approach. In this model, anyone can propose an answer to a data request, and it is deemed true unless contested during a predefined verification period. The resolution of disputes is then determined through a democratic tokenholder vote.

    Human Intelligence in Oracle Design

    What sets UMA apart is its departure from traditional price-feed oracles. Instead of relying solely on automated processes, UMA’s optimistic design, conceptualized since 2014, introduces the element of human intelligence. This is particularly significant in the realm of Web3 projects, where converting arbitrary data into code is often impractical.

    What is Uma – How does it Work?

    On Ethereum, UMA creates open-source infrastructure for “priceless” financial contracts. To be more exact, it consists of two elements. The first is the invaluable financial contract templates that were utilized to construct synthetic coins. The decentralized oracle service, which is used to govern and enforce contracts on UMA, is the second.

    The priceless decentralized finance (DeFi) contracts are made up of APIs that provide pricing data on-chain on a regular basis in order to handle Defi contracts. These contracts, on the other hand, are vulnerable to bribery, manipulation, flash loan attacks, and ad-hoc market occurrences. In the event of a dispute, however, priceless financial contracts are contracts that just demand the writing of a price on-chain (which is designed to be rare). Contracts on UMA with priceless contracts reduce dependency on oracles, making them less subject to attacks.

    The optimistic oracle, as well as the data verification process, are the foundations of the oracle (DVM). The upbeat Oracle enables contacts to seek and get price information rapidly. It functions as a generic escalation game between contracts that want to make a price request and the DVM, UMA’s dispute resolution mechanism. Unless it is disputed, the price established by the optimistic oracle will not be conveyed to the DVM. The method enables contracts to obtain price information in a predetermined amount of time without the necessity for an asset’s price to be posted on-chain.
